Service Status
Status List
info BaseInfo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/staustList/list
Request Method
- post
LP Registration Management
Register All
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/relayAccount/registerAll
Request Method
- post
Example of Successful Return
{
"code": 0,
"message": ""
}Parameter Description of Successful Return Example
| Parameter Name | Type | Explain |
|---|---|---|
| code | string | none |
| message | string | none |
Base Data
Get chainlist
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/baseData/chainDataList
Request Method
- get
Example of Successful Return
{
"code": 0,
"result": [
{
"id": "641829f689bd1782d7ec2871",
"chainId": 9000,
"name": "Avax c chain",
"chainName": "AVAX",
"tokenName": "AVAX"
},
{
"id": "641829f689bd1782d7ec2873",
"chainId": 9006,
"name": "bsc smart chain",
"chainName": "BSC",
"tokenName": "BNB"
}
],
"message": ""
}Configuration Resources
Create Configuration Resources
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/configResource/create
Request Method
- post
Request Parameter Example
{
"appName": "amm01",
"version": "0.8",
"clientId": "dfjdjf822",
"template": "{\"hedgeAccount\":\"a001\",\"hedgeType\":\"CoinSpotHedge\"}"
}Description of Request JSON Fields
| Parameter Name | Mandatory | Type | Explain |
|---|---|---|---|
| appName | Y | string | none |
| version | Y | string | none |
| clientId | Y | string | none |
| template | Y | string | none |
Example of Successful Return
{
"code": 0,
"result": {
"id": "64194f5589bd1782d7ec81e2"
},
"message": ""
}Parameter Description of Successful Return Example
| Parameter Name | Type | Explain |
|---|---|---|
| code | string | |
| result | Object | |
| id | string | |
| message | string |
Get a Config Resource
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/configResource/get
Request Method
- post
Request Parameter Example
{
"clientId": "MTY3OTM4NzU1MjQxMA=="
}List Resources
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/configResource/list
Request Method
- post
Example of Successful Return
{
"code": 0,
"result": [
{
"id": "641950ec89bd1782d7ec83cf",
"templateResult": "",
"template": "{\"hedgeAccount\":\"a001\",\"hedgeType\":\"CoinSpotHedge\"}",
"clientId": "dfjdjf8",
"appName": "amm01",
"version": "0.8",
"versionHash": "9b759040321a408a5c7768b4511287a6"
},
{
"id": "641954d189bd1782d7ec8793",
"templateResult": "{\"hedgeAccount\":\"a00103\",\"hedgeType\":\"CoinSpotHedge\"}",
"template": "{\"hedgeAccount\":\"a001\",\"hedgeType\":\"CoinSpotHedge\"}",
"clientId": "dfjdjf822",
"appName": "amm01",
"version": "0.8",
"versionHash": "9b759040321a408a5c7768b4511287a6"
}
],
"message": ""
}Parameter Description of Successful Return Example
| Parameter Name | Type | Explain |
|---|---|---|
| code | string | |
| result | Object | |
| id | string | |
| templateResult | string | |
| template | string | |
| clientId | string | |
| appName | string | |
| version | string | |
| versionHash | string | |
| message | string |
Edit Resource
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/configResource/edit
Request Method
- post
Request Parameter Example
{
"appName": "amm01",
"version": "0.8",
"clientId": "MTY4MDg1OTE3MjQ0Mg==",
"template": "{\"hedgeAccount\":\"a001\",\"hedgeType\":\"null\"}",
"templateResult": "{\"chainDataConfig\":[{\"chainId\":9006,\"config\":{\"maxSwapNativeTokenValue\":\"5\",\"minSwapNativeTokenValue\":\"0.5\"}},{\"chainId\":9000,\"config\":{\"maxSwapNativeTokenValue\":\"80\",\"minSwapNativeTokenValue\":\"0.5\"}}],\"hedgeConfig\":{\"hedgeAccount\":\"a001\",\"hedgeType\":\"CoinSpotHedge\",\"accountList\":[{\"accountId\":\"a001\",\"exchangeName\":\"binance\",\"spotAccount\":{\"apiKey\":\"arelVdKxWiBm7Mp77hx8nONoWLp37gyrVd7CrKMwD7XOBBxWiCeg3JIehiJ0nAoO\",\"apiSecret\":\"ohMRXHppUEvZScqQ1mq5lmIu5FAAX4xzM4fW6RDfy2gG0gLBOOIYG6eKeNJV7wTo\"},\"usdtFutureAccount\":{\"apiKey\":\"a4aa44de63eaddde555b7bceab84ae98931a225313480010dc3c7b8467771b2b\",\"apiSecret\":\"32246bd97a55369c99d49cccbbe0de3541f6f46c4f5729fe34db286957e235ec\"},\"coinFutureAccount\":{\"apiKey\":\"a4aa44de63eaddde555b7bceab84ae98931a225313480010dc3c7b8467771b2b\",\"apiSecret\":\"32246bd97a55369c99d49cccbbe0de3541f6f46c4f5729fe34db286957e235ec\"}}]}}"
}Description of Request JSON Fields
| Parameter Name | Mandatory | Type | Explain |
|---|---|---|---|
| appName | Y | string | none |
| version | Y | string | none |
| clientId | Y | string | none |
| template | Y | string | none |
| templateResult | Y | string | none |
Example of Successful Return
{
"code": 0,
"message": "",
"result": "641954d189bd1782d7ec8793"
}Parameter Description of Successful Return Example
| Parameter Name | Type | Explain |
|---|---|---|
| code | string | |
| result | string | |
| message | string |
Relay Account
register a account
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/relayAccount/register
Request Method
- post
Request Parameter Example
{
"name": "lp-account-01",
"profile": "my lp account"
}Example of Successful Return
{
"code": 0,
"result": {
"id": "641940ea89bd1782d7ec7617",
"name": "lp-account-01",
"lpIdFake": "100",
"relayApiKey": "jsdjkfdjjdfs112"
},
"message": ""
}Parameter Description of Successful Return Example
| Parameter Name | Type | Explain |
|---|---|---|
| code | string | |
| result | Object | |
| id | string | |
| name | string | |
| lpIdFake | string | |
| relayApiKey | string | |
| message | string |
Delete a account
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/relayAccount/delete
Request Method
- post
Request Parameter Example
{
"id": "643fcab7f92f26ca1ec0b533"
}All Account
info BaseInfo
Brief Description
- None
Request URL
- /lpnode/lpnode_admin_panel/relayAccount/list
Request Method
- get
Example of Successful Return
{
"code": 0,
"result": [
{
"id": "641940ea89bd1782d7ec7617",
"name": "lp-account-01",
"profile": "my lp account",
"lpIdFake": "100",
"lpNodeApiKey": "eiirrooror8",
"relayApiKey": "jsdjkfdjjdfs112"
}
]
}Parameter Description of Successful Return Example
| Parameter Name | Type | Explain |
|---|---|---|
| code | string | |
| result | array | |
| id | string | |
| name | string | |
| profile | string | |
| lpIdFake | string | |
| lpNodeApiKey | string | |
| relayApiKey | string |